Transaction efa2da7a59b7b06a9dc85f3639d4cf8ea86326208b34795145e8e462b56f2559
1 Input
2 Outputs
- efa2da7a59b7b06a9dc85f3639d4cf8ea86326208b34795145e8e462b56f2559:0
- efa2da7a59b7b06a9dc85f3639d4cf8ea86326208b34795145e8e462b56f2559:1
value 38520378
address 1ADm31HtEqdbUr3qjPABdxVPrYgGLfxAdV
value 242818467
address 14BrJPT852xm6242mFiq4f8eUF36F9yzm8